Este tema en particular levanta mucho revuelo todo el tiempo en Internet, muchos se apasiona en acaloradas conversaciones de foros virtuales y foros en persona donde el tema es tocado.
Hoy quiero compartir desde una perspectiva personal sobre este tema:
Pros del Software Libre
- Es gratuito, definitivamente, a quien no le gusta lo que cueste cero dólares y sea funcional, esta es la característica más relevante que percibo.
- Es abierto, muy útil para los newbies(novatos) en la fase de iniciación, el momento de diseccionar software “literalmente” y aprender del interior de este, o en el caso de expertos, permite flexibilidad para potenciar las capacidades de un software y ofrecer mayor enfoque sobre problemáticas específicas, aquí el Software libre es campeón.
- Es comunitario, en esta parte, cuando pones cientos de mentes que bajo la mentalidad de “gratis lo recibes, gratis lo das” a laborar sobre parches y actualizaciones el resultado es una potencia descomunal a la hora de obtener enriquecimiento de las aplicaciones, esto lo logra el software libre, pero, aquí el control de versiones supone un reto siempre, pero mínimo problema frente a la potencia de depuración que una enorme comunidad laborando como hormigas supone.
Contras del Software libre:
- Es LIBRE: el apellido del mismo, le da pauta al gran “bug”, así como hay buenas personas hay personas muy malas, líneas de código que son supuestos parches esconden otros agujeros o vulnerabilidades que solo estos mismos tipos saben cómo explotar en el mercado negro del software.
- No hay soporte dedicado, si bien es cierto hay apoyo de la comunidad, no hay un soporte dedicado que te salve la vida en el peor de los escenarios “un hacking” de tipo critico por ejemplo, nadie ofrece garantía, nadie se hace responsable.
- Es ocultamente “de paga”, para tener un nivel de calidad aceptable, por lo general es requerido contratar una o más empresas especializadas que cobran dinero. Y en algunos casos, definitivamente lo barato viene saliendo más caro.
Pros del Software de Licencia:
- Soporte, definitivamente esta es la mayor fortaleza que tiene el software de licencia, pues existe una detallada y extensiva tendencia por el aspecto de la “competitividad”
- Es cerrado, el hecho de que solo un pequeño nicho dentro de una empresa maneja los fuentes hace que esto le dificulte (al menos un poco mas) a los crackers el proceso de daños –hacks y por ende esto beneficia a los usuarios finales, al tener soluciones más finamente confeccionadas.
- Es tendencioso a ser más seguro, realmente uso “tendencioso” porque en definitiva ni software libre, ni de licencia son irrompibles, sin embargo, el software de licencia por el inciso anterior tiende a ofrecer un tanto más de resistencia en la parte de seguridad.
Contras del Software de licencia:
- El costo, definitivo, esta es la espina en la mano y es que últimamente el costo de licencias para la mayoría de los software y hablando de cualquier varidad, sube más y más.
- Eficiencia, en la mayoría de los casos porque hay sus excepciones, el hecho de comprometerse por “dinero” a brindar una Aplicación con un nivel de eficiencia por encima de la media.
- Personalización, si bien es cierto que existe un fuerte análisis al momento que un software de licencia con enfoque a cierta área, en algunos casos es requerido un mayor grado de precisión, el software de licencia es hermético, con lo cual el factor de personalización se ve drásticamente afectado.
En la medida que pasa el tiempo, el paradigma-opinión de las personas varia, de momento, esta es mi óptica, cuáles son tus impresiones personales?, siéntete libre de opinar…
Soy desarrollador y fanático de la playa, actualmente trabajo para una gran empresa a tiempo completo en México. En mis tiempos libres los dedico a escribir tutoriales o reseñas, además de compartir recursos que puedan ser de utilidad.
galvaroe@pixelg.org